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3663 24804023723 086697
96933053027 0883674
96933053027 0883674
69913 52958279 63 6545134856
All about undefined
Interested in learning more?
96933053027 0883674
69913 52958279 63 6545134856
See more
81280 43639658 077
8465 47447 5769 221111133
See more
992 94948352187
82 54 595150709 11420466937
See more